Unusual Complications after Transcatheter Aortic Valve Replacement: Gastrointestinal Bleeding in an Elderly Patient with Previous Coronary Artery Bypass Graft: A Case Report
The care of an 89-year-old male patient with severe as who underwent transcatheter aortic valve replacement (TAVR) with the MYVAL 24.5 valve is the subject of this case study. The patient’s medical history was complicated by osteoporosis, advanced age, and a prior coronary artery bypass graft (CABG)...
